Output fe104af65110ce1825a2252c33a94770ba870c0ba18692c6024ac8eb989f611a:1

value
2002388
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c45b75d8705bdbe73b8e796892b1a89a5dfd1826 OP_EQUALVERIFY OP_CHECKSIG
address
1JuF1NhgzSuxMbn3YgY7ZYjrnvRyrW1F2Y
transaction
fe104af65110ce1825a2252c33a94770ba870c0ba18692c6024ac8eb989f611a
spent
true